Discovery of Dismembered Girl's Body in Constantine Brings Marwa Bougachiche Case to the Forefront

The discovery of a dismembered girl's body in an advanced stage of decomposition in the mountain of El Wahch in the province of Constantine, 700 kilometers east of the Algerian capital, has caused a stir in the Algerian public opinion. Many attributed the body to the girl Marwa Bougachiche, who disappeared on May 22 after taking her last exam in her life.

Marwa is 13 years old and disappeared under mysterious circumstances without a trace since then, making her case a subject of wide interest among activists and local pages, who linked the incident to the tragedy of the young girl.

However, Marwa's father categorically denied these reports, confirming that the body found is not hers, and that the family still has no news of their daughter. He said: "These are just rumors fabricated by some pages, and we continue to search for her in cooperation with the security authorities overseeing the operation and taking all necessary measures."

Marwa's father added that the family is going through difficult times, with all family members and relatives intensively participating in the search campaign, hoping to find any information that could help locate her.

It is worth noting that Marwa was a diligent student with excellent results, not suffering from any problems or conflicts inside or outside the home. She was leading a normal life at home before suddenly disappearing, which makes her disappearance more mysterious and raises concerns about the circumstances of the incident.

In recent days, there have been rumors circulating about Marwa being with one of her relatives, which her father completely denied, expressing his complete rejection of any talk not based on facts, considering discussing a missing girl of this age without respecting the family's feelings as inappropriate.

The case is still open, and investigations are ongoing to uncover the truth behind Marwa's disappearance, amid the solidarity of the people of Constantine and the security authorities, who are working to gather information to reach the truth.
